Turkey's total oil imports decreased by 3.9 percent, crude oil imports fell by 23.7 percent but an increase was seen in diesel by 33.2 percent in December 2017 year-on-year, according to the country's energy watchdog's report on Wednesday.
Diesel imports increased by 33.2 percent to 1.3 million tonnes and crude oil imports decreased to 1.9 million tonnes in December 2017, Energy Marketing Regulatory Authority (EMRA) said.
Turkey's oil product imports overall decreased to 3.9 million tonnes in December 2017, compared to December 2016.
Aviation fuel imports increased by 213.2 percent to 7 thousand tonnes in December 2017 compared to the same month last year.
Production of total oil refinery products decreased by 26 percent to 1.9 million tonnes and diesel production decreased by 16.3 percent to 802 thousand tonnes.
In December, total fuel sales rose by 1.3 percent to 2.3 million tonnes compared to the same month last year.
